Bulloch BT9000, Esso, Touch, and BT9000(PC) Settings

In the Bulloch section, you can configure settings for the following Bulloch cash registers models:

  • BT9000
  • Esso
  • Touch
  • BT9000(PC)

To access the Bolloch cash register settings:

  1. At the top left of the Cash Register form, select Advanced.
  2. From the CR Brand list, select Bulloch.
  3. From the CR Model list, select the Bulloch CR model you need:
  • BT9000
  • Esso
  • Touch
  • BT9000(PC)

For the Bulloch CR models listed above, you can configure the following settings:

  • In the Bulloch section:
  • CR IP: The P address of the cash register.
  • Tax strategy: The tax strategy settings to be applied at the cash register. For more details, see Configuring Taxation Strategy for Cash Register.
  • CR login: The user name to log in to the cash register.
  • CR password: The password to log in to the cash register.
  • Allow Price modifier: Enable this option to allow sending Price Modifier promotions to the cash register.
  • Folders: Paths to folders where data is stored at the cash register:
  • Smb service name: The name of the Samba network shared folder. Specify the service name if Samba is used as the transport protocol.
  • CR inbox folder: The path to the folder where incoming data is stored.
  • CR outbox folder: The path to the folder where outgoing data is stored.
  • CR archive folder: The path to the folder where archive data is stored.
  • CR error folder: The path to the folder where error messages are stored.
  • In the Advanced section:
  • Pricebook download to CR: Select the format of the downloaded pricebook file. This option is displayed only for the BT9000(PC) CR model. The following formats are available:
  • Proprietary: This format is selected by default.
  • NAXML

In addition to configuring settings, you can perform the following activities:

  • Wipe Out Price Book: Use this button to delete the Price Book at the cash register and upload the Price Book from CStoreOffice® to the cash register instead.
  • Upload Full Items Price Book: Use this button to upload the Price Book from CStoreOffice® to the cash register. This operation is used in conjunction with items updates. After clicking this button, you need to accept changes in the Cash Register Updates Manager. As a result, full price book is uploaded to the cash register. For details, see Reviewing and Accepting Changes.

    After the Upload Full Items Price Book button is clicked, it changes its color to indicate the process of pushing the price book data. Once the price book updates are accepted, the button returns its initial color.
